Lady Raiders Fall to No. 6 Vanderbilt 7-0
MT Media Relations
Freshman Claudia Szabo lost to Vanderbilt's No. 62 Amanda Fish 6-1, 6-0 Tuesday. (MT) Send this photo to your mobile phone!
NASHVILLE, Tenn. - Middle Tennessee women's tennis (3-4) fell 7-0 to 6th ranked Vanderbilt (8-1) Tuesday at the Currey Center.

Earlier in the day, the Lady Raider tandem of Jennifer Klaschka and Ann-Kristin Siljestrom received a ranking of 45 in the latest ITA poll. The doubles team had Vanderbilt's Annie Menees and Audra Falk, ranked 33rd, down 4-1, but the Dores roared back to take No. 1 doubles 8-4. Vanderbilt swept the doubles to take a 1-0 lead into singles play.

Vanderbilt made quick work of Middle Tennessee. The top-ranked Dores proved why they had knocked off six ranked teams in eight matches, prior to the team's meeting with the Lady Raiders.

Siljestrom dropped her first match of the season, as the Stockholm, Sweden native fell at No. 4 doubles. She lost to Amanda Taylor 6-0, 6-2.

The Lady Raiders will play their third consecutive ranked opponent when the team travels to Huntington, Virginia to take on No. 63 Marshall on Friday. Match time is set for 4 p.m. Central.
